Ideas GOAT Formula
I know this is subjective to everyone but I reel like I have arrived at a pretty solid starting point here and think we could make it even better if people much smarter than me had some opinions on it
I have attached a photo of the top 30 players this formula produces at the start of 2025 preseason and I think its pretty solid with a few players in wrong spots.
Formula:
20 * mvp + 15 * dpoy + 20 * champ + 20 * finalsMvp + 5 * allLeague1 + 5 * allDefensive1 + 3 * allLeague2 + 3 * allDefensive2 + 1 * allLeague3 + 1* allStarMvp + 2 * allStar + 1 * ewa
Let me know what you all think.

Rosters Progression vs Age Framework for Roster Building
Curious to get the community's thoughts on the below mental model I use while optimizing my roster through trades.
Note: Of course, leagues ebb and flow and you adjust accordingly. Sometimes you have multiple 80+ GOAT tier players, sometimes you're lucky to have 1 or 2 in the 70s. Some draft classes are duds, others are stellar. And so on...
Here's how I'm evaluating who I want to target keeping or trading for:
- Optimize toward having ALL roster slots at or above "Strong progression" line
- 20/42, 21/50, 22/58, 23/64, 24/68, 25/70 are the major benchmarks
- If you can't get all roster slots filled this way, get as close as possible
- This usually results in trying to have 1-3 of the top players in each age cohort for ages 20-26
- Between "Strong progression" and "Never keep", I'm only holding players who are very cheap relative to their age and OVR.
- Often 24/58 to 26/60 types who cost 10-25% of a max contract (i.e. $5-12.5M/yr on standard financial settings)
- Offload anyone at "Never Keep" or below
- Will do this even if it means having an open roster slot or two - the $ savings / SRPs you'll get are more valuable than end of bench players who never see playing time
- Graph ends at 26 years old, because 27+, I only keep 70+ OVR or cheap solid 60+ OVR vets needed to fill out roster slots
- Ex: In my current league, there's a dearth of strong PGs, so I'm holding a 31/67 @ $25M/yr even though he's old
Common contract considerations:
- Max or near-max contracts only for players at or above "GOAT potential" line.
- Most relevant when re-signing players around 22/64 to 25/74 range
- Try to trade for players in this range locked into long-term contracts well below Max rates
- Ex: Trading a 24/72 max contract to a contending team for a 23/69 who just re-signed at $25M/yr before progressing + other strong prospects/picks
- If a player is at the higher end of cost range for their Age/OVR combination and regresses below Strong progression line, offload immediately for value and to free up cap space
- Be wary of holding onto high draft picks who don't stay above Strong progression
- $8-12M / yr on an end of bench player who's unlikely to move toward GOAT tier can kill your cap space
- Plus, they often want big contract renewals even if they're no longer looking like that amazing prospect they were at the draft
